About the role
Responsibilities
- Own the data product vision and roadmap for assigned Operations data domains, aligned with Data & AI strategy.
- Partner with Investment Operations and Technology leadership to translate business objectives into actionable data product initiatives.
- Act as a domain expert across operations data, including investment reference data, performance, treasury, and fund accounting.
- Lead discovery and requirements sessions to translate data needs into product capabilities such as gold tables, APIs, and semantic layers.
- Collaborate with data engineering to design and ship pipelines using Databricks, ensuring reliability and scalability.
- Establish data quality standards, SLAs/SLOs, data contracts, and reconciliation controls for critical datasets.
- Implement domain-aligned governance, including entitlements, lineage, and auditability using Unity Catalog.
- Drive initiatives to automate data delivery workflows and reduce operational risk through improved platform design.

About the Company
Ares Management Corporation is a leading global alternative investment manager offering clients complementary primary and secondary investment solutions across the credit, real estate, private equity, and infrastructure asset classes. With approximately $644 billion of assets under management, Ares operates a global platform with more than 4,400 employees across North America, South America, Europe, Asia Pacific, and the Middle East.
